ホームページ > ウェブフロントエンド > jsチュートリアル > vueで現在アクティブ化されているルートを取得する方法

vueで現在アクティブ化されているルートを取得する方法

小云云
リリース: 2018-03-19 10:31:00
オリジナル
2012 人が閲覧しました

ルート オブジェクト (ルート情報オブジェクト) は、現在の URL を解析して取得した情報と、URL に一致するルート レコードを含む、現在アクティブ化されているルートのステータス情報を表します。ルート オブジェクトは不変であり、ナビゲーションが成功するたびに新しいオブジェクトが生成されます。この記事では、Vue で現在アクティブ化されているルートを取得する方法を主に説明します。これは非常に参考になるので、皆さんのお役に立てれば幸いです。編集者をフォローして見てみましょう。皆さんのお役に立てれば幸いです。

route オブジェクトは複数の場所に表示されます:

コンポーネント内、つまり $route オブザーバー コールバック内の this.$route

router.match(location) 戻り値 (main.js で取得可能)現在有効化されているルーティング情報)

注:

this.$route のパスと router.match(location) のパスは異なり、両方とも属性 fullpath を持ち、値はハッシュの連結です。私の場合、router.match(location) は常に /login と等しく、ハッシュはトレース ポイント # を持つ現在のルーティング パスであるため、router.match(location) を使用します。現在アクティブ化されているルートを取得するには、ハッシュ属性が使用されるだけですが、その理由はまだ不明です。 。

以上がvueで現在アクティブ化されているルートを取得する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ート